If the police arrive at larry’s office without probable cause or a warrant and demand to search the premises, what laws are violated?

The 4th amendment is violated. No person shall be subject to unwarranted search or seizure without probable cause. The police can’t search without the warrant unless someone is in danger or evidence is getting disposed of.
